T Smith, born March 24, 2000, is a Canadian professional ice hockey player in the Pittsburgh Penguins (NHL) National Hockey League. The New Jersey Devils selected him in the first round, 17th overall, in the 2018 NHL Entry Draft.
Smith was the first overall pick in the 2015 WHL Bantam Draft by the Spokane Chiefs. Smith was awarded Chiefs’ Rookie of the Year and Scholastic Player of the Year during the junior season. Smith had a breakthrough season the following year, setting a new franchise record for most points in a single game by a defensive man and receiving the WHL Scholastic Player of the Year award. Smith was also named Defensive Player of the Year.
